“Rock Me, Baby” is a sultry, swing-tempo, minor-key blues-rock track with a classic “Fever” pulse. Mid-tempo and lyric-forward, it’s built for a female solo lead. The melody spans only a major ninth, making it effortless to deliver night after night. Great as a trio or full-band arrangement. Behind the Song
Some songs have deeply meaningful origins, rooted in a moment or emotion I was trying to capture. And some are written just because of a cool idea, concept, or vibe. This song is one of the latter. I was a on a longish road trip by myself to a city five hours away. The first two lines hit me not far into the trip, and the song was written by the time I got there.
This song is about those rare instances when you meet someone on the dance floor and the chemistry is instant and electric. By the end of the night, you absolutely know this person will be important in your life. Does it happen often, or at all?
I’m a dreamer. I deal in the improbable possibilities of romance. So I say yes.
